Most of the shops are close if you go to kuromon market around 5-7pm. As you already know, it is a Market, so it is best if you go there in the morning.

I got lost in kuromon market while searching for dotombori around 5pm, most of the shops closes there but there will be some shops open but a lot of them are in the midst of closing already.

The time closing for shops in dotombori varies. You still can see shops open around 9pm, but i advice to go there around 7-8pm.

Lots of restaurant there for you to pick for dinner. I tried eating ramen there at a store which has a giant dragon head (There's 2 ramen store which got giant dragon head, which is a totally different store btw.) and the ramen was quite nice.

I tell you, if you want to walk from kuromon -> dotombori -> shinsaibaishi -> namba, 1 night is not enough. Namba itself is big, And near kuromon market if i'm not wrong, there's a street called american street which I wanted to go to but don't have time.

Which hotel in Osaka are you staying?
I thought the common check-in time is around 3pm?
By the time you settle-in, rest and transport, you would reach
Osaka-Castle around 4pm.
By 6pm, its already quite dark (like Malaysia 7.30pm)
due to the autumn season and nothing much else to see at Osaka Castle at 6pm in the dark.
Osaka Castle Musuem entrance closes at 5.30pm by the way, see if you can rush there in time.
It is a long walk from the station to the Castle, ~ 1 hours?
So, by 6.30pm, Shinsaibashi will look like a high-class pasar malam.

Just a friendly tip so that you won't make the same mistake I did.

Take the train to Temmabashi to reach Osaka Castle, don't look at the maps provided and think
the nearest trains stations are what you thought they are.
Nearly lost when going there, stopped at Umeda as it looks and near,
and due to the locals or me not understanding each other's language
even with a map as the map is in English.
